About Chhote Gumia Pal Village
Chhote Gumia Pal is a small village in Lohandiguda tehsil, in the district of Bastar, Chhattisgarh.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 436, made up of 218 males and 218 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 1,000 females per 1000 males. The village covers 331.5 hectares hectares. Its pincode is 494447, shared with the other villages in the same post office area.

Getting to Chhote Gumia Pal
The census records public bus service for Chhote Gumia Pal as Available. Private bus service is recorded as Available within 5 - 10 km distance. For rail, the census notes the nearest railway station as Available within 10+ km distance. These entries describe what was recorded in 2011 and services may have changed since.
